Audaciter set for five in a row

’ Audaciter yesterday won his fourth race in 16 days for his Christchurch owner, Mr Les Ling.

With characteristic dash and power he showed more of his front-running powers to win the North Canterbury Racing Club’s President’s Handicap under top weight of 59.5. He will carry 4.5 kg less tn the Canterbury JockeyClub's George Adams Handicap at Riccarton next Monday, and even with the likes of Grey Way in opposition h. will come in for much attention. Audaciter is now winner

of 17 races for Mr Ling, who bought him three years ago. He started his present golden patch of form in the Hororata Cup early last month, then won two races including the cup at the Nelson meeting. Audaciter is prepared at Riccarton by Kelvin Quayle, and as usual was ridden by Phillip Smith, who rated him skilfully from the front end. Karnak, ridden at one kilo overweight, finished doggedly for second with a run that also brought her in for some notice as a prospective light-weight for the George Adams Handicap.

She was a neck better than Deep Mystery, but had covered less ground than the third horse which , as usual, was inclined to run keenly. Butch showed fair ability for fourth. He appeared to be in cramped quarters briefly at about half way, but rallied encouragingly to finish only half a length from the third horse. Mr Richmond was even more impressive in running fifth. He ran out of racing room when keen to quicken in the straight. Top Secret picked up several places from the 1200 m for a promising sixth.
